sofiabean8.gifFor a great baby shower gift or for your own baby, I love the Sofia Bean Baby Boutique! Sofia Bean offers soft cotton baby clothes and blankets embroidered with Sofia Bean exclusive animal designs.

One reason I love this site so much is that it focuses on one thing (baby clothes) and does it perfectly. Sofia Bean offers onesies, hats, bibs, pants and blankets which all go together and have adorable designs. They are also very reasonably priced — onesies (long or short-sleeved) are $14 each or $29.99 for 3. Blankets are $20 each. They are high quality, really soft and can be machine-washed and dried.

boxcornerchicklogo_3.gifThe other reason I love this site is the adorable gift/storage box in which you can package your gift. I have friends and family having babies all around me, so I ordered one of the gift boxes recently to see if they were as cute as they looked on-line. Well, it was better! This was the cutest gift presentation I have seen in a long time!

It comes with a red ribbon tied through the handles and is just so adorable! I was really excited to open the box, and it wasn’t even for me! I am also a terrible present-wrapper, so I love this! For $50, you can get a gift box, a onesie, pants, a blanket, a bib (or hat), and 10 newborn diapers. For $100, you can get 2 of everything! You can also build your own box with whatever combinations you choose. Love it!
